WebSep 15, 2024 · Infants (4 to 11 months): Should average 12 to 15 hours of sleep per day, including naps. Toddlers (12 to 35 months): Should average 11 to 14 hours, including naps. Preschoolers (3 to 5 years): Should average 10 to 13 hours per day. WebJun 9, 2024 · This is important because inflammatory processes can elevate risk for cardiovascular disease. Stroke, heart attack and death. Researchers report a modest link between both short and long sleep duration, or nine hours or more at a time, and stroke.
